推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
在Linux操作系统VPS环境中,构建高效数据库备份方案至关重要。通过精心设置,可确保数据安全与恢复效率。该方案涉及在VPS上配置数据库备份,实现自动化与定期执行,以保障数据完整性。
本文目录导读:
随着互联网技术的快速发展,数据安全已经成为企业及个人用户关注的焦点,数据库作为存储数据的核心组件,其安全性和稳定性至关重要,本文将为您详细介绍如何在VPS环境下搭建一套高效、稳定的数据库备份方案,确保数据安全无忧。
VPS简介
VPS(Virtual Private Server,虚拟私有服务器)是一种基于虚拟化技术的服务,将物理服务器分割成多个独立、隔离的虚拟空间,每个虚拟空间都拥有独立的操作系统、IP地址、CPU资源等,VPS具有成本较低、性能稳定、管理方便等特点,广泛应用于企业级应用、个人网站搭建等领域。
数据库备份的重要性
数据库备份是确保数据安全的关键措施,主要有以下作用:
1、数据恢复:当数据库遭受攻击、误操作或硬件故障时,通过备份文件可以快速恢复数据。
2、数据迁移:在更换服务器或升级数据库版本时,备份文件可以帮助迁移数据。
3、数据审计:备份文件可以用于对历史数据的查询、分析,有助于发现潜在问题。
4、数据保护:定期备份可以防止数据丢失,确保数据完整性。
VPS环境下搭建数据库备份方案
1、选择合适的数据库备份工具
在VPS环境下,有多种数据库备份工具可供选择,如mysqldump、pg_dump、备份精灵等,根据实际需求和数据库类型,选择合适的备份工具。
2、制定备份策略
备份策略包括备份频率、备份类型、备份存储位置等,以下是一些建议:
(1)备份频率:根据数据更新速度,可设置为每天、每周或每月进行一次备份。
(2)备份类型:可分为完全备份、增量备份和差异备份,完全备份会备份整个数据库,适用于数据量较小的情况;增量备份仅备份自上次备份以来发生变化的数据,适用于数据量较大且更新频繁的情况;差异备份备份自上次完全备份以来发生变化的数据,介于完全备份和增量备份之间。
(3)备份存储位置:可以选择本地存储、远程存储(如云存储)等,远程存储可以防止本地硬件故障导致数据丢失。
3、搭建备份脚本
以下是一个简单的MySQL数据库备份脚本示例:
#!/bin/bash 配置数据库信息 DB_USER="root" DB_PASS="password" DB_NAME="testdb" BACKUP_PATH="/path/to/backup" 设置备份文件名 BACKUP_FILE="$BACKUP_PATH/backup_$(date +%Y%m%d%H%M%S).sql" 执行备份命令 mysqldump -u $DB_USER -p$DB_PASS $DB_NAME > $BACKUP_FILE 删除7天前的备份文件 find $BACKUP_PATH -name "*.sql" -type f -mtime +7 -exec rm -f {} ; 输出备份完成信息 echo "Backup completed: $BACKUP_FILE"
4、设置定时任务
将备份脚本设置为定时任务,确保定期执行,以下是一个使用cron定时任务的示例:
每天凌晨2点执行备份脚本 0 2 * * * /path/to/backup_script.sh
在VPS环境下搭建数据库备份方案,可以确保数据安全无忧,通过选择合适的备份工具、制定备份策略、搭建备份脚本和设置定时任务,可以轻松实现高效、稳定的数据库备份,定期检查备份文件的有效性,确保在关键时刻能够快速恢复数据。
以下为50个中文相关关键词:
VPS, 数据库备份, 备份策略, 备份工具, 数据恢复, 数据迁移, 数据审计, 数据保护, 虚拟私有服务器, 备份频率, 备份类型, 备份存储位置, 备份脚本, 定时任务, 数据安全, MySQL, mysqldump, pg_dump, 备份精灵, 数据库备份方案, 数据库备份方法, 数据库备份技巧, 数据库备份实践, 数据库备份经验, 数据库备份重要性, 数据库备份注意事项, 数据库备份优势, 数据库备份缺点, 数据库备份策略制定, 数据库备份脚本编写, 数据库备份定时任务设置, 数据库备份文件管理, 数据库备份存储方案, 数据库备份安全性, 数据库备份可靠性, 数据库备份效率, 数据库备份自动化, 数据库备份与恢复, 数据库备份与迁移, 数据库备份与审计, 数据库备份与保护, 数据库备份与维护, 数据库备份与优化, 数据库备份与监控
本文标签属性:
VPS搭建数据库备份:vps搭建服务器